The base mathematical model of wave adsorption developed earlier was improved. The possibility of it practical application is shown for the calculations of gas hromatography technologies. Gas hromatography technology of neon and helium extraction from neon-helium mixture obtained in blocks of large cryogenic air separation units (ASU) is offered. For the consideration of technology features is accepted that in the ASU enters 100000 nm3/h recycled air. Sizes of hromatography column, which are necessary to separate the neon-helium mixture are reported and other indicators of technology are realized.Downloads
